Financial Modeling Group (Java / Scala / C++ / Python / Big Data)

  • Competitive
  • New York, NY, USA
  • Permanent, Full time
  • BlackRock
  • 21 Sep 17

  The mission of the Advanced Data Analytics team is to employ data science to: * Help clients make more informed investment decisions * Create analytical solutions through collaboration with our partners * Culture of the team is very open, agile, quantitative, and entrepreneurial.  We

 

The mission of the Advanced Data Analytics team is to employ data science to:



  • Help clients make more informed investment decisions

  • Create analytical solutions through collaboration with our partners

  • Culture of the team is very open, agile, quantitative, and entrepreneurial. 

We believe that:


  • Scale requires collaboration, flexibility, and an unwavering commitment to automation

  • To be insightful requires experimentation and perseverance

  • Challenging problems are the cauldron of creativity and discovery

  • Data empowers and confers competitive advantage on those who use the right tool for the job

 


The role will be a key member of the FMG Advanced Data Analytics group in New York. The position will be an individual interested in the field of big-data infrastructure, machine learning algorithms, and data visualization solutions. In addition to having passion in these fields, the candidate should be comfortable with multiple programming languages (Scala, Java, Python, R …) and multiple technologies (Hadoop, Spark, Tensorflow, RDBMS…) to support the modeling and infrastructure requirements of the diverse nature and demands of the team. In addition, the candidate will be supporting more senior members of the team to create tools and solutions that can help our clients with their investment decisions.



Minimum Requirements:


  • Interest in computational statistics, in particular, the applications of machine learning and natural language processing to behavioral finance. We are working at the intersection of mathematics, computer science, and computational finance.

  • Ability to face off with finance and business subject matter experts on challenging problems

  • Aptitude for learning new programming languages to support data science projects

  • 1-3 years of professional experience in at least two of the following: Java, Scala, C++, JavaScript, Python, R, SQL, Julia or similar

  • Knowledge of distributed compute such as Apache Spark or Tensorflow

  • Experience with open source data science tool kits and technologies 

Ideal Candidate:



  • Apache Hadoop, Pig, Spark, Cassandra, HBase, Storm, Kafka

  • Distributed caches, e.g. Ignite, Hazelcast

  • R (markdown, dplyr, glmnet, caret, other packages)

  • Experience building high quality interactive web based applications

  • Angular, React, Highcharts, d3, R (ggplot2, shiny)

  • Cloud computing platforms, e.g. AWS, GCE and configuration management systems, e.g. Ansible 

BlackRock is proud to be an Equal Opportunity and Affirmative Action Employer.  We evaluate qualified applicants without regard to race, color, national origin, religion, sex, disability, veteran status, and other statuses protected by law.